Асимметричное шифрование – это криптографический метод, который использует пару различных ключей для безопасной связи и защиты данных. В отличие от симметричного шифрования, где используется один ключ, асимметричное шифрование основано на двух взаимосвязанных ключах: открытом ключе и закрытом ключе. Открытый ключ предназначен для шифрования информации и может быть свободно распространяться, в то время как закрытый ключ используется для расшифровки и хранится в строгой конфиденциальности.
Принцип работы асимметричного шифрования основан на математических функциях, которые легко вычисляются в одном направлении, но практически невозможно обратить без знания закрытого ключа. Открытый ключ и закрытый ключ образуют криптографическую пару, где данные, зашифрованные открытым ключом, могут быть расшифрованы только соответствующим закрытым ключом. Эта асимметрия обеспечивает надежную защиту конфиденциальной информации и позволяет безопасно передавать сообщения между сторонами, которые никогда ранее не обменивались секретными ключами.
Асимметричное шифрование играет центральную роль в архитектуре блокчейна и криптовалютных систем. Оно используется для создания цифровых подписей, которые подтверждают подлинность транзакций и авторство сообщений. Каждый участник блокчейн-сети получает уникальную пару ключей: открытый ключ служит адресом кошелька, который может быть опубликован, а закрытый ключ остается секретным и используется для подписания транзакций. Это обеспечивает безопасные цифровые взаимодействия и гарантирует, что только владелец закрытого ключа может авторизовать передачу активов.
Асимметричное шифрование защищает чувствительную информацию и содействует формированию доверия в цифровых экосистемах. Благодаря использованию криптографических ключевых пар, система обеспечивает целостность операций и подтверждает идентичность участников без необходимости централизованного органа. Этот метод шифрования способствует основам архитектуры безопасности блокчейна, позволяя участникам сети взаимодействовать с уверенностью в защите своих данных и активов. Асимметричное шифрование остается одним из ключевых элементов криптографии, обеспечивающим конфиденциальность, аутентификацию и неотказуемость во всех отраслях, где требуется высокий уровень безопасности.
Асимметричное шифрование использует пару ключей:открытый и закрытый。Симметричное использует один ключ для кодирования и декодирования。Асимметричное безопаснее,но медленнее。Симметричное быстрее。
Открытый ключ служит для шифрования данных и является общедоступным。Закрытый ключ предназначен для расшифровки и должен храниться в безопасности。Вместе они обеспечивают безопасную передачу и защиту данных。
Асимметричное шифрование применяется в удаленном доступе,защите коммуникаций и аутентификации,криптографических подписях транзакций,шифровании приватных ключей кошельков,защите данных и обеспечении конфиденциальности блокчейн-систем。
RSA基于大数分解难题,ECC基于椭圆曲线离散对数问题。ECC密钥长度更短,计算效率更高,提供相同安全级别时所需密钥更小,性能优势明显。
Отправитель подписывает сообщение своим приватным ключом, получатель проверяет подпись открытым ключом отправителя。 Это гарантирует подлинность источника и целостность сообщения в блокчейне。
Основные риски:слабое управление ключами,компрометация приватных ключей,атаки на реализацию。Меры защиты:использование длинных ключей(2048-4096 бит),регулярное обновление ключей,безопасное хранилище,двухфакторная аутентификация。